溫馨提示×

hbase thrift服務穩定性

小樊
87
2024-12-23 18:55:03
欄目: 大數據

HBase Thrift服務是HBase數據庫的一個組件,它提供了基于Thrift接口的遠程過程調用(RPC)層,允許客戶端通過標準 Thrift 協議與 HBase 進行交互。HBase本身是一個高可用的分布式數據庫,通過多種機制確保數據的持久性和系統的可用性。以下是關于HBase Thrift服務穩定性的相關信息:

HBase Thrift服務的穩定性

HBase Thrift服務通常與HBase集群的高可用性配置一起考慮。HBase通過WAL(Write-Ahead Logging)和HDFS等機制來保證數據在節點故障時的高可用性。此外,HBase還支持主從和主主兩種復制模式,以適應不同的業務需求。

HBase高可用性實現原理

  • 數據冗余存儲:HBase使用HDFS作為底層存儲,數據默認存儲三副本,確保數據的持久性和冗余性。
  • 故障恢復機制:利用WAL和HDFS處理數據故障恢復,HMaster負責重新分配Region給其他RegionServer,并根據WAL中的日志信息進行數據恢復。
  • 負載均衡:通過Region分裂和合并機制實現負載均衡,確保系統的均衡負載。

HBase Thrift服務的監控

為了確保HBase Thrift服務的穩定性,監控是一個關鍵方面。HBase提供了內置的監控工具,如HBase Shell和HBase Web UI,以及通過JMX進行監控。此外,還可以使用第三方監控工具如Grafana和Prometheus來監控集群狀態和性能指標。

監控指標和建議

  • 監控指標:包括讀延遲、寫延遲、RPC延遲、讀吞吐量、寫吞吐量、存儲空間利用率、內存利用率等。
  • 監控工具推薦:Grafana和Prometheus是監控HBase集群狀態和性能指標的優秀工具,可以提供可視化界面和強大的查詢功能。

通過上述方法,可以有效地監控HBase Thrift服務的性能和狀態,確保其穩定運行和高效性能。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女